You will be accountable for monitoring, maintaining and managing high volume customer collection accounts and will reduce delinquency for your assigned portfolio. This opportunity reports into the Collections Manager and is responsible for the collections of TMX Group and its subsidiaries.

The role involves interacting with business leaders to manage their outstanding receivables through ongoing efforts to reduce aged accounts receivable (AR) while maintaining good relationships with both internal and external clients.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Regular review of AR aging to identify delinquent balances and prioritize collection efforts, focusing on outstanding balances and invoice aging to improve results year over year.
  • Collaborate with Business Divisions to address delinquent, unresolved aged balances, and disputes.
  • Review customer accounts and process refunds, unapplied cash, credits, and adjustments as applicable.
  • Educate customers on payment terms, contractual obligations, and the consequences of late or non-payment.
  • Implement professional collection efforts to improve collection rates while maintaining client relationships.
  • Perform account reconciliations, trace invoicing and payment history, and handle allocations and adjustments across multiple accounts and divisions.
  • Maintain detailed notes on all past due accounts and document collection methods and actions taken.
  • Provide administrative support and handle customer inquiries related to billing and payments.
  • Follow up on unclear payments and perform skip tracing to update contact and billing information.
  • Identify and report risks related to bankruptcy and collection activities.
  • Build and maintain internal processes for transaction processing, including write-offs, and review system updates and community discussions for process improvements.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to ensure accurate and timely payment allocations and updates.
  • Encourage clients to use faster and safer payment methods such as PAD, wire, online, or EFT to streamline collections and reduce receivables and risk.
